VergeOS uses semantic versioning with two different formats:
Legacy Format: Major.Minor.Patch.Hotfix (e.g., 4.13.4.2)
New Format (26.0+): Year.Quarter.Minor.Patch (e.g., 26.0.1)
First two digits represent the year (25 = 2025, 26 = 2026)
Third digit represents the quarter development started (0-3)
Remaining digits represent minor and patch versions
Update Process
Minor, Patch, and Hotfix updates support live system updates with no impact to running workloads
Major version updates may require a system reboot to complete the update process
Updates should always be performed sequentially within a major version (e.g., 4.13.2 → 4.13.3 → 4.13.4)
When upgrading from 4.13.x to 26.0.x, follow the upgrade path through 4.13.4.2 first
